Southwestern Style Pinto Bean Nachos

When it comes to nachos, the Southwest makes ‘em best. Luckily, you can enjoy them no matter where you are on the map thanks to this recipe featuring Bush's® Southwestern Style Pinto Beans®.

  • Temps de préparation

    15 Min

  • Temps de cuisson

    10 Min

  • Pour

    4

Besoin d’ingrédients?

Ingrédients

Pour : 4
  • 1 pkg (12 oz) sauceless precooked pulled pork (optional)
  • 2 cans (15.4 oz) Bush's® Southwestern Style Pinto Beans, drained
  • 1 head iceberg lettuce, rinsed, dried and finely chopped
  • 1 pkg (12 oz) yellow corn tortilla chips
  • ½ small red onion, diced
  • 2 small tomatoes, diced
  • 1 container (8 oz) white cheese dip
  • Pickled jalapeño slices
  • fresh cilantro, chopped

Let's Get Cookin'

Instructions de cuisson

  1. 1
    CHAUFFER

    Follow package directions to reheat fully cooked pulled pork. Set aside. Heat or microwave beans according to can directions till warm.

    • Pulled pork

    • 2 cans of beans

  2. 2
    MÉLANGER

    Mix beans and pork together in a large bowl.

    • 3
      ÉTAGER

      Chop lettuce and divide between four dinner plates. Layer desired amount of tortilla chips on top of lettuce. Layer pork and beans mixture on top of the tortilla chips.

      • Lettuce

      • Tortilla chips

    • 4
      GARNIR

      Top with red onion, diced tomatoes and white cheese sauce. Add pickled jalapeño and cilantro for extra flavor.

      • Onion

      • Tomatoes

      • Cheese

      • jalapeño

      • Cilantro

    • 5
      NOTE

      Pulled pork can be optional. Nutritional information includes pork.
